The SR and XL formulations are believed to have the same side effects, but to a lesser degree than the IR formulation. To minimize your risk of developing side effects, start low and increase slowly. There is some concern about the generic version of Wellbutrin XL and the FDA is conducting an investigation of patient complaints. Perhaps the SR would be the best way to go at this point. Bupropion SR is available in 100mg and 200mg tablets.
